I'm never exactly sure how to differentiate Brutalism from simple Modernism
raw, dank stinky concrete. it's not the style that makes brutalism so hated.
it's the materials and how they are presented and how those materials weather..and how they smell...and absorb and retain stains...and how quickly they crumble.
and how so many cities and developers used the style to cut corners, save money and "throw up" raw concrete buildings and pass them off as legitimate architecture.
